
Console Obsession says: "Remember the Crash mode in the Burnout games? Well, Dangerous Golf is very much like that but with a destruction-happy golf ball bouncing around indoor environments as opposed to a car speeding towards a busy road junction. It’s with little surprise that the game takes so much inspiration from this Burnout mode – some of the people that work for Three Fields Entertainment, the developer of the game, previously worked on the Burnout games at Criterion Studios. The crash mode in Burnout was about being the instigator of as much chaos as possible, causing other innocent road users to be caught up in massive crashes. Dangerous Golf is also about causing chaos and destruction."
